Output 0108e0578b062184d16cba1eb4657a503dc56628817370116abf4a748ac22289:1

value
13886
script pubkey
OP_0 OP_PUSHBYTES_20 c5fd95c38167483144608583db4ca38c1caf5a64
address
bc1qch7etsupvayrz3rqskpakn9r3sw27knymt0wxl
transaction
0108e0578b062184d16cba1eb4657a503dc56628817370116abf4a748ac22289
confirmations
57958
spent
true